From September 22 to March 21, in what direction must an observer in the Northern Hemisphere look to see sunrise? (15.5)

  1. (a) east
  2. (b) northeast
  3. (c) southeast
  4. (d) west

A cylinder with a piston contains 0.153 mol of nitrogen at a pressure of 1.83×105 Pa and a temperature of 290 K. The nitrogen may be treated as an ideal gas. The gas is first compressed isobarically to half its original volume. It then expands adiabatically back to its original volume, and finally it is heated isochorically to its original pressure.
